#1f1297 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1f1297 is composed of 12.2% red, 7.1%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.5% cyan, 88.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 245.9 degrees, a saturation of 78.7% and a lightness of 33.1%. #1f1297 color hex could be obtained by blending #3e24ff with #00002f.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#1f1297

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02010b is the darkest color, while #f9f8f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f1297

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#535356 is the less saturated color, while #1505a4 is the most saturated one.
